I was at my pcp today and he says I have walking pneumonia and bronchitis.  This was all confirmed via tests as well.  Grrr.... I thought this cough was hanging around a bit too long.  I am starting a round of steroids,  along with anti biotics.  i have never taken a steroid before.  My parents had/have been on them before and it was crazy what they had to go through.  My dad developed diabetes from steroids and my mom got this moon faced weigh gain from them.  Both of them were on them long term at times due to their illnesses. 
What can I expect from being on a steroid?  I have had bronchitis before but not pneumonia.  So this is kinda scary for me.

Leah, you should not have those kinds of effects from being on steroids for a short time for an illness. You see those long term effects in patients who take them for months/years. They will most likely make you very hungry and thirsty, normal reaction. They also could make you feel a bit jittery/hyper. Hope you feel better soon.
